How to install ZArchiver 1.0.7 APK in Android?
How much time it will take to install ZArchiver?
The installation process for installing ZArchiver 1.0.7 APK in your Android device will take up to 2 minutes.
Required things to install ZArchiver?
- Smartphone.
- Android Operating System.
- ZArchiver Downloaded File.
Find out downloaded file.
First of all to install ZArchiver in your Android device you need to find out the downloaded file. Generally the files downloaded in Android devices are stored in Download folder. So you can also check the ZArchiver downloaded file in download folder.
Click On Downloaded File.
After finding downloaded file in this step you need to click on the downloaded file in order to install ZArchiver 1.0.7 APK in your Android device.
Follow installer instructions.
In this step after clicking on downloaded file you need to follow the installer instructions. Mostly all installer instructions are maximum same only some installer can have different instructions which you need to follow.
